THE PLACE

Hap Chan Tomas Mapua Branch is a typical Chinese restaurant that you can see in Binondo. The ambiance of the old Chinese restaurant plus a modern fusion of architecture is really a great combination. By the way they will served you a house blend hot tea while waiting for your food.

 Address: 600 Tomas Mapua Street, Santa Cruz, Manila, Metro Manila, Philippines

 thesatastefiedchef(4)

thesatastefiedchef

THE FOOD

We ordered our favorite, Yangchow fried rice, Hakaw and Sauteed Beef Broccoli. And we also added assorted cold cuts on our order.

 thesatastefiedchef(1)

Hap Chan’s Yangchow (more or less P220) had no yellow coloring and had a lot of ingredients incorporated like shrimp, chives, chorizo, egg and cabbage. What I really like about their Yangchow is you can feel that it has no grease in it. They incorporate just a few oil when they cook their Yangchow.

thesatastefiedchef(3)

Hap Chan’s Sauteed Beef Broccoli (more or less P240) on the other hand has so much oil in it. (I think you can see it in the photo), but even though it has a lot of oil, the beef is tender and eat to chew, which I think is really cooked to perfection. The broccoli is crunchy which I really love and adore because I really wanted my veggies to be half cooked only.

 thesatastefiedchef(5)

Hap Chan’s Hakaw (P90) had 8 pleats they follow the traditional way of doing Hakaw. The wrapper of their Hakaw was very translucent and not easily peeled when you use fork or chopsticks. When I cut the Hakaw into two it had spices inside, which I think gives the Hakaw a new twist.

thesatastefiedchef(2)

Hap Chan’s assorted cold cuts (P315) are very luscious. It contains century egg, asado, tofu, seaweeds and something that tastes like squid but looks like an asado.

For our dessert, which I don’t have a photo is Almond Jelly with Lychee (P60) this dessert freshen up our mouth after the very savory and spicy meal we ate.

THE TEMPERATURE

Hap Chan served their food straight from their wok to the plate.

THE SERVER

Hap Chan’s servers are not smiling when they approach you to get your order. They are really hard to ask for something and they are gossiping while at work and they even answer back to one of the customers complaining why their food is not yet served. To quote what they said “Frozen po kasi yung isda (the fish is still frozen)”. I think they should not answer that way and they should apologize to the customer for not serving it on time.

THE PRICE

Hap Chan’s price is very affordable we ate so much, but it only cost us P1,025. The food is good for 2-3 persons.

 THE VERDICT

Our Hap Chan’s overall verdict for the food is very good except for the Beef Broccoli due to over usage of oil. I would give their servers a score of 1 out of 5 due to their attitude towards customer and I think they should encourage their employees to treat their customers as VIP as possible. I can visit Hap Chan again, but I think not this branch anymore due to the poor customer service.
